This is very interesting, but why would they release it now?
Firmware 1.2 beta will be reaching the payers sometime soon, which means there may be a leak. The fact is, however, that the beta can be tweaked last minute by Apple to get around this hack (it seems that the main issue for Apple is related to mere security checks). It's likely that 1.2b will patch this, which means it won't work on 1.2 final.
The fact that the Dev team released so much information about the exploit shows that they have something bigger planned for 1.2 and they don't mind letting this exploit be blown away... Or maybe they genuinely believe that Apple can't fix this one...

this should work forever...
i hope the do release it now and not wait until june... JUNE IS SO FAR AWAY :'(
anyway apple cant patch this as it is an exploit in bootloaders that they are using to make the iphone allow unsigned code. Just like ipsf hasnt been patched out, thats because the bootloader was the one exploited. anysim can be fixed as its just patching out the sim checks on baseband level, and the baseband is almost always updated.
So from my understanding, this CANT BE FIXED BY APPLE as it is impossible to do so. and if this cant be fixed, why not release it now
